From 63f57b64f9a74513c66d441753d1c062a217d71c Mon Sep 17 00:00:00 2001 From: wellenvogel Date: Sun, 28 Nov 2021 12:16:09 +0100 Subject: [PATCH] make destructor of GwMessage protected --- lib/queue/GwMessage.h |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/lib/queue/GwMessage.h b/lib/queue/GwMessage.h index 027ffdb..5c9a877 100644 --- a/lib/queue/GwMessage.h +++ b/lib/queue/GwMessage.h @@ -22,9 +22,9 @@ class GwMessage{ String name; protected: virtual void processImpl()=0; + virtual ~GwMessage(); public: GwMessage(String name=F("unknown")); - virtual ~GwMessage(); void unref(); void ref(); int wait(int maxWaitMillis); @@ -46,9 +46,9 @@ class GwRequestMessage : public GwMessage{ protected: virtual void processRequest()=0; virtual void processImpl(); + virtual ~GwRequestMessage(); public: GwRequestMessage(String contentType,String name=F("web")); - virtual ~GwRequestMessage(); String getResult(){return result;} int getLen(){return len;} int consume(uint8_t *destination,int maxLen);